About Timberscombe

Timberscombe finds its quietude amidst the rolling Quantock Hills. It lies 4.2 km south-south-west of Minehead (from Minehead: bearing 197°T, OS grid SS 955 421), and is situated south-east of Wootton Courtenay village. The village is embraced by a landscape that whispers of ancient woodland and open pastures, where the light often falls with a soft, golden hue upon the stone walls. A small stream, the Washford, meanders through the valley, its gentle murmur a constant companion to the village's peace. The parish church of St. Andrew, with its sturdy tower, stands as a landmark of enduring faith, its stones weathered by centuries of wind and rain. Timberscombe's character is one of gentle persistence, a place where the rhythm of agricultural life still holds sway, and the air carries the scent of damp earth and distant hedgerows.
